My Take
I'll be honest: Dan Bilzerian fascinates me less as a personality and more as a phenomenon. He understood earlier than almost anyone that a lifestyle itself could be the product, that poker winnings, private jets, and curated excess could be packaged into an audience of millions. Whether you find that admirable or hollow probably says as much about you as about him. My own take is that he is a shrewd marketer wearing the costume of a hedonist, and the controversies that follow him are part of the machine. As a case study in attention economics, he is genuinely instructive.
Overview
Daniel Brandon Bilzerian (born December 7, 1980) is an American social media personality, businessman, and political candidate known for his lavish lifestyle, online presence, and controversial public statements. He gained notability from about 2013 for his extravagant lifestyle and photos with scantily dressed models on social media. He is the eldest son of businessman Paul Bilzerian.
